Welsh Rugby Emergency Aid a success

Date Posted: 01 Aug 2013

A rugby specific emergency aid course designed by St John Cymru Wales in collaboration with the Welsh Rugby Union, is one of the central initiatives championed by the WRU’s Club Operations team as part of the drive to recruit and train more volunteers.

St John Cymru Wales is the country’s leading first aid charity and its vision is to have a first aider on every street in Wales.  This vision has created a strong foundation for a successful partnership with the WRU.  The Welsh Rugby Emergency Aid course has proved a resounding success with 74 clubs accessing the WRU Recruitment Grant to host the course and access equipment. 

As a result, 816 volunteers will participate in Rugby Emergency Aid training.

Julie Paterson, WRU Head of Group Compliance, said: “The WRU sees Emergency Aid provision as a vital function in providing a safe rugby environment and this view was reinforced by our recent Club Census.

“We’re delighted with the number of clubs and volunteers who have engaged in this programme, clearly demonstrating there is a need for this kind of training.” 

“With this in mind, the programme will again be available to clubs for the forthcoming season.”

In addition to funding the training, the WRU Recruitment Grant was also used to provide individual first aid kits for the volunteers, supplied in partnership with St John Wales.
